Is there a way to download songs from gremmie.net to a Mac to import into iTunes? On my PC I can right click and "save as" any song, but Macs don't have a right click option (that I can tell). Unfortunately my iTunes collection is on our Mac home computer so up until now I've downloaded songs to my PC, burned them to a disc, and then transferred them from the disc to the Mac. I'd like to short cut this if possible. Any help will be greatly appreciated. Thanks.

    Click on the file and it will play in a browser window. Once the file is fully loaded there should be a pull down menu and select "save source". Once saved on desktop just drag over to iTunes library.

    as far as a right click option, hold down control when you click and it should do the same thing.
